Question about the PS3 remote - does it work well for netflix and allow you to navigate menus and check how much time your movie has left with a single button?

The PS3 is my video workhorse and I figure it would be a better and cheaper investment than a fancy expensive Harmony remote.
__________________

Last edited by 2DMention; 03-27-2011 at 12:03 PM..
Reply With Quote
Old 03-27-2011, 12:28 PM   #2475
Quote:
Originally Posted by 2DMention View Post
Question about the PS3 remote - does it work well for netflix and allow you to navigate menus and check how much time your movie has left with a single button?

The PS3 is my video workhorse and I figure it would be a better and cheaper investment than a fancy expensive Harmony remote.
The remote works well with Netflix on PS3. It's a personal choice, but I do prefer the menu setup on the 360, but the PS3 has everything available to you as well including your New Releases, Recommendations, Previously Viewed, and obviously your Instant Queue.

The display button on the remote pops up a timer on the top left (in very small font), the audio available and the video quality. Rewinding and fast-forwarding presents you with a chapter-type menu that previews segments of the video so you can see where to stop as you can't see an accurate time read-out outside of a minute count.

Plus, the best thing about the PS3 remote is you don't need line of sight.

Do the fancy expensive Harmony remotes control the PS3 video functions?
Reply With Quote
Old 03-27-2011, 01:32 PM   #2477
Quote:
Originally Posted by 2DMention View Post
Thanks for the reply.

Do the fancy expensive Harmony remotes control the PS3 video functions?
Most need a IR USB sensor sold by them for the ps3, sold not with the remote.

90% of the Harmony's only have the IR, not IR + bluetooth, If i recall.

If you have a sony tv or maybe another brand, it can work with the HDMI-Control feature though, Thats how i use my Harmony remote with the PS3 instead of buying the Infer-Red USB thingie so it can pick up the remote signals, since the pS3 only has bluetooth.
